Subject: Concern about declining standards and safety at the gym
I’m writing as a regular member to share some concerns about the recent decline in standards at the gym. I’m doing so because I value the facilities and would like to continue training here, but things have noticeably gone downhill over the past few months.
In particular:
Need more classes. Classes are frequently overcrowded, which affects both safety and the quality of the sessions.
Certain classes and activities are being cancelled on the same day, often at short notice, making it hard to plan workouts.
Cleanliness is not at the standard it should be for a busy gym – floors, changing areas, and some equipment often feel poorly maintained.
I’m also concerned about member safety and atmosphere. Recently, I witnessed a man shouting aggressively at a woman as he left the gym, and no staff member intervened. That kind of situation really needs visible staff presence and a clear response to ensure members feel safe. Certainly Jeff was one of the few trainers that seemed on top of the situation but he is no longer there, losing staff like that is disappointing.
There are also some equipment issues that need urgent attention:
Class mats are worn out and need replacing.
Many of the bikes in the group cycling studio clearly need servicing (noisy, loose, or not adjusting properly).
It’s a real shame, as the facilities themselves are excellent and the gym has a lot of potential. With better maintenance, clearer standards, and more proactive management, it could be a fantastic place to train again.
I’d appreciate it if you could let me know how you plan to address these issues and over what kind of timeframe.

Reception staff is really good, as are the instructors I have experienced. Great to have a flat bottomed teaching pool for aqua aerobics classes. There is a good selection and frequency of classes generally.
However, the availability of aqua aerobic classes is well below the level of demand and it is challenging to get access to them. Aqua aerobics is one of the best types of exercise for older/disabled people, which is an under-served constituency of the club. I rely on the aqua aerobic classes because I am disabled and they are crucial to my mobility. There are 2 problems: 1. There are a number of aqua classes that are charged for that are not full, while there is demand from members who are already paying for classes through their membership, but have to pay extra for these classes. Some are controlled by the Council, but others by Better, which could be changed to normal member classes. Even more ludicrous is that some of the "pay for" classes are designed for disabled people that I can't get access to, because I'd have to change my membership to a more expensive membership category. It makes absolutely no sense, but I've been told that "it's just the way things are and can't be changed". If these classes were free, they would be full and people would feel less frustrated about not being able to get into the number of classes they need to remain healthy and fit. 2. There is strong demand for a Saturday class. We've been told it is impossible as there is no space on Saturdays. Management won't even consider trying to make a space for such a class, which will increase availability for both working and non working people. Once again, the older/disabled constituency is poorly served on Saturdays. Many of us have approached management to discuss and try to find solutions but are just told no, nothing can change.
